Description

ICD-10 code G97.5 refers to postprocedural hemorrhage of a nervous system organ or structure following a procedure. This code is part of the broader category of postprocedural complications, specifically focusing on hemorrhages that occur in the nervous system after surgical interventions or other medical procedures.

Clinical Description

Definition

Postprocedural hemorrhage is defined as bleeding that occurs as a complication following a medical or surgical procedure. In the context of G97.5, this bleeding specifically affects the nervous system, which includes the brain, spinal cord, and peripheral nerves. Such hemorrhages can arise from various types of procedures, including but not limited to neurosurgery, spinal surgery, or interventions involving the vascular structures of the nervous system.

Etiology

The causes of postprocedural hemorrhage can vary widely and may include:
- Surgical trauma: Damage to blood vessels during surgery can lead to bleeding.
- Coagulation disorders: Patients with underlying bleeding disorders or those on anticoagulant therapy may be at higher risk.
- Infection: Infections can lead to inflammation and subsequent bleeding.
- Vascular malformations: Pre-existing conditions such as arteriovenous malformations can predispose patients to hemorrhage.

Symptoms

Symptoms of postprocedural hemorrhage in the nervous system may include:
- Headaches: Often severe and persistent.
- Neurological deficits: Such as weakness, numbness, or changes in sensation.
- Altered consciousness: Ranging from confusion to loss of consciousness.
- Seizures: New-onset seizures may occur due to increased intracranial pressure or irritation of the brain.

Diagnosis

Diagnosis typically involves:
- Clinical evaluation: Assessing symptoms and medical history.
- Imaging studies: CT scans or MRIs are crucial for identifying the location and extent of the hemorrhage.
- Laboratory tests: To evaluate coagulation status and rule out other causes of bleeding.

Management

Management of postprocedural hemorrhage may include:
- Observation: In cases of minor bleeding, careful monitoring may be sufficient.
- Surgical intervention: In cases of significant hemorrhage, surgical evacuation of the hematoma may be necessary.
- Supportive care: This may involve managing intracranial pressure and providing symptomatic relief.

Clinical Information

The ICD-10 code G97.5 refers to "Postprocedural hemorrhage of a nervous system organ or structure following a procedure." This condition is characterized by bleeding that occurs in the nervous system after a surgical or invasive procedure. Understanding the clinical presentation, signs, symptoms, and patient characteristics associated with this condition is crucial for effective diagnosis and management.

Clinical Presentation

Postprocedural hemorrhage in the nervous system can manifest in various ways, depending on the location and extent of the bleeding. Common clinical presentations include:

  • Neurological Deficits: Patients may exhibit weakness, numbness, or paralysis in specific body parts, depending on the affected area of the nervous system.
  • Altered Consciousness: Changes in consciousness, ranging from confusion to loss of consciousness, may occur, particularly if the hemorrhage is significant.
  • Seizures: New-onset seizures can be a sign of intracranial hemorrhage, especially if the bleeding affects the brain tissue.
  • Headache: Patients often report severe headaches, which may be sudden in onset and can be indicative of increased intracranial pressure or irritation of the meninges.

Signs and Symptoms

The signs and symptoms of postprocedural hemorrhage can vary widely but typically include:

  • Focal Neurological Signs: These may include weakness or sensory loss in specific limbs, speech difficulties, or visual disturbances, depending on the area of the brain affected.
  • Signs of Increased Intracranial Pressure: Symptoms such as vomiting, bradycardia, and hypertension may indicate increased pressure within the skull.
  • Meningeal Signs: Stiff neck, photophobia, and other signs of meningeal irritation may be present if the hemorrhage leads to meningeal irritation.
  • Changes in Vital Signs: Patients may exhibit changes in blood pressure and heart rate, which can indicate a response to pain or stress from the hemorrhage.

Patient Characteristics

Certain patient characteristics may predispose individuals to postprocedural hemorrhage:

  • Age: Older adults are at a higher risk due to age-related vascular changes and comorbidities.
  • Comorbid Conditions: Conditions such as hypertension, coagulopathy, or the use of anticoagulant medications can increase the risk of bleeding.
  • Type of Procedure: The risk of hemorrhage varies with the type of procedure performed. Neurosurgical procedures, such as craniotomy or spinal surgery, carry a higher risk compared to less invasive interventions.
  • Previous History of Hemorrhage: Patients with a history of previous hemorrhagic events may be at increased risk for recurrence following procedures.

Diagnostic Criteria

The ICD-10 code G97.5 refers to "Postprocedural hemorrhage of a nervous system organ or structure following a procedure." This code is used to classify cases where there is bleeding in the nervous system following a surgical or invasive procedure. Understanding the criteria for diagnosing this condition is essential for accurate coding and appropriate clinical management.

Diagnostic Criteria for G97.5

1. Clinical Presentation

  • Symptoms: Patients may present with neurological deficits, altered consciousness, headache, or other signs indicative of intracranial pressure or hemorrhage. Symptoms can vary based on the location and extent of the hemorrhage.
  • Timing: The onset of symptoms typically occurs shortly after the procedure, although delayed presentations can occur depending on the type of procedure and the patient's condition.

2. Medical History

  • Procedure Details: A thorough review of the patient's medical history is crucial. The specific procedure performed (e.g., craniotomy, lumbar puncture, or other neurosurgical interventions) should be documented, as this provides context for the potential complications.
  • Risk Factors: Consideration of pre-existing conditions that may predispose the patient to bleeding, such as coagulopathy, use of anticoagulants, or other medications that affect hemostasis.

3. Imaging Studies

  • Neuroimaging: CT scans or MRIs are typically employed to confirm the presence of hemorrhage. Imaging should show evidence of blood accumulation in the relevant areas of the nervous system, such as the brain or spinal cord.
  • Location and Extent: The imaging results should detail the location (e.g., epidural, subdural, intraparenchymal) and the volume of the hemorrhage, which can influence management decisions.

4. Exclusion of Other Causes

  • Differential Diagnosis: It is essential to rule out other potential causes of hemorrhage, such as trauma, spontaneous hemorrhage, or vascular malformations. This may involve additional imaging or laboratory tests to assess coagulation status.

5. Documentation of the Procedure

  • Operative Report: The surgical or procedural report should clearly document the nature of the procedure, any intraoperative complications, and the immediate postoperative course. This documentation supports the diagnosis of postprocedural hemorrhage.

6. Follow-Up Assessments

  • Monitoring: Continuous monitoring of the patient post-procedure is critical. Any changes in neurological status should prompt immediate evaluation for potential hemorrhage.
  • Repeat Imaging: If there is clinical suspicion of hemorrhage, repeat imaging may be necessary to assess for new or worsening bleeding.

Treatment Guidelines

Postprocedural hemorrhage of a nervous system organ or structure, classified under ICD-10 code G97.5, refers to bleeding that occurs after a surgical or invasive procedure involving the nervous system. This condition can arise from various procedures, including neurosurgery, spinal surgery, or interventions like biopsies. Understanding the standard treatment approaches for this complication is crucial for effective management and patient recovery.

Understanding Postprocedural Hemorrhage

Definition and Causes

Postprocedural hemorrhage is characterized by bleeding that occurs in the postoperative period, which can lead to significant morbidity if not addressed promptly. Common causes include:
- Surgical trauma: Damage to blood vessels during the procedure.
- Coagulation disorders: Pre-existing conditions that affect blood clotting.
- Anticoagulant therapy: Use of blood thinners that may increase bleeding risk.
- Infection or inflammation: These can exacerbate bleeding tendencies post-surgery.

Symptoms

Patients may present with various symptoms, including:
- Neurological deficits (e.g., weakness, sensory loss)
- Headaches
- Changes in consciousness or alertness
- Signs of increased intracranial pressure (e.g., vomiting, altered mental status)

Standard Treatment Approaches

Initial Assessment

The first step in managing postprocedural hemorrhage is a thorough clinical assessment. This includes:
- Physical examination: To identify neurological deficits and assess vital signs.
- Imaging studies: CT scans or MRIs are often performed to locate the source of bleeding and assess its severity.

Medical Management

  1. Stabilization: Ensuring the patient is hemodynamically stable is critical. This may involve:
    - Administering intravenous fluids.
    - Monitoring vital signs closely.

  2. Medications: Depending on the severity of the hemorrhage, medications may include:
    - Antihypertensives: To control blood pressure and reduce the risk of further bleeding.
    - Coagulation factors or agents: If a coagulopathy is identified, specific treatments may be necessary to reverse anticoagulation or enhance clotting.

Surgical Intervention

In cases where conservative management is insufficient, surgical intervention may be required:
- Evacuation of hematoma: If a significant hematoma is present, surgical drainage may be necessary to relieve pressure and prevent further neurological damage.
- Repair of vascular injuries: If bleeding is due to a specific vascular injury, surgical repair may be indicated.

Postoperative Care

Postprocedural care is essential to monitor for complications and ensure proper recovery:
- Neurological monitoring: Regular assessments to detect any changes in neurological status.
- Follow-up imaging: To evaluate the resolution of hemorrhage and monitor for any recurrence.

Multidisciplinary Approach

Management of postprocedural hemorrhage often involves a multidisciplinary team, including:
- Neurosurgeons: For surgical interventions.
- Neurologists: For ongoing neurological assessment and management.
- Critical care specialists: For patients requiring intensive monitoring and support.
